MTD not working

Hi all,

Iam wroung some where please do let me know

I am just calculation YTD and MTD using set analysis

here is my expression

=if(Category='receivable',sum({<YEAR={'<=$(=MAX(YEAR))'},MONTH={'<=$(=MAX(MONTH))'}>} $(EXP)))

here if YTD is working fine,but not MTD ..,

please do let me know where iam wroung

Not applicable
Author

Try below code.

sum({<Year={'$(vMaxYear)'},Month={'$(vMaxMonth)'},Day={'<=$(vMaxDay)'},Date=,MonthYear=>} Amount)

Variables:-

vMaxYear=Max(Year)

vMaxMonth=Date(max(Date),'MMM')

vMaxDay=day(max(Date))
